Specifications

Braking

Brake Calipers Auriga Sub - black rotors
Brake Levers Auriga Sub

Drive

Bottom Bracket Truvative GigaXpipe
Cassette (Rear Cogs) CSM96 black polish 11-32
Chain X9 black nano finish
Crank Truvativ Firex 3.3 44/32/22
Pedals Octopus

Gearing

Derailleur Front Shimano SLX
Derailleur Rear Shimano XT
Gears 27
Shifter(s) Shimano SLX

General

Extras Rack: Cannondale SI Rack, Lights: Spanninga Micro FF LED front/Hermanns Google LED rear, Chainguard: Hesling Esencia, Fenders: Cannondale Curan lite black, Kickstand: Cannondale Atran Stylo
Grips Cannondale "Vintage" leather chrome rings
Handlebar Cannondale Metro black
Headset HeadShok bearing
Saddle Brooks 17 Cannondale edition
Seat Post Cannondale C3/chrome plated
Stem Cannondale C3 Headshok adjustable black

Suspension

Forks SI Fatty Ultra

Wheels

Hubs Shimano hubdynamo Alfine/Shimano XT
Rims Cannnondale C2 black
Spokes DT Swiss black/black
Tyres (Front & Back) Schwalbe Surpreme 622 x 37
Wheel Size 700c

UK warranty

Cannondale frames have a lifetime warranty against manufacturing defects in materials and/or workmanship for the original owner. All other components, including HeadShok forks, suspension parts, frame fixtures and finishes (paint and decals) are covered against manufacturing defects in materials and/ or workmanship for one year. Parts from other manufacturers are covered by their own warranties.

A very beautifull bike but also too expensive. The parts chosen by Cannondale are the cheaper parts (Tektro brakes, Shimano Deore chainwheel and derailleur and so on.
The Octopus trappers have to be replaced or the 3rd time in 6 months because of the poor quality of the bearings. The nano black finish of chain and cassette has disappeared very rapidly. These parts rust very quick now because of the absence of any coating.
If you lubricate them the lubricant reaches the rotor from the rear brake. Bolts and nipples of the spokes rust too. The front fender lacks a rubber protection against mud, is too short and therefore the underside the bike gets very dirty.
Once when I took my bike out of the garage the chain stopped turning and disturbed the front shifting gear. I also had to retighten the bearing of the steering.

Verdict: a beautifull expensive bike with poor quality.
